Creating an Effective Workout Plan

Find What Works for You

Not everyone loves running or lifting weights, and that’s okay. The best workout plan is the one you’ll actually stick to. Whether it’s dancing, swimming, cycling, or even gardening, find something that gets your heart rate up and makes you happy.

Here’s a sample workout routine to get you started:

  • Monday: Full-body strength training (30 minutes)
  • Tuesday: Cardio (jogging, cycling, or brisk walking for 45 minutes)
  • Wednesday: Rest or yoga (30 minutes)
  • Thursday: Core workout (20 minutes)
  • Friday: High-intensity interval training (HIIT) (25 minutes)
  • Saturday: Outdoor activity (hiking, kayaking, or playing a sport)
  • Sunday: Active recovery (stretching or light walking)

Nutrition: The Foundation of Your Transformation

Eat Smart, Not Less

Diet culture often leads people to believe that eating less is the key to success. Wrong! The secret lies in eating smarter. Focus on whole, nutrient-dense foods like f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and healthy fats. Avoid processed junk and excessive sugar—it’s not doing you any favors.

Here’s a simple meal plan to inspire you:

  • Breakfast: Oatmeal with berries and almond butter
  • Lunch: Grilled chicken salad with quinoa and avocado
  • Dinner: Baked salmon with steamed broccoli and brown rice
  • Snacks: Greek yogurt, nuts, or sliced veggies with hummus

Hydration: The Secret Weapon

Drink Up, Buttercup

Hydration is often overlooked, but it plays a massive role in your summer body transformation. Water helps with digestion, muscle function, and even skin health. Aim for at least 8-10 glasses a day, and adjust based on your activity level.

Pro tip: Carry a reusable water bottle with you everywhere. It’s a small habit that makes a big difference.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Don’t Fall into These Traps

Even the best intentions can go awry if you’re not careful. Here are some common mistakes to avoid during your summer body transformation:

  • Skipping meals or over-restricting calories
  • Overtraining and neglecting rest days
  • Comparing yourself to others on social media
  • Expecting immediate results

Remember, consistency beats intensity every time. Slow and steady wins the race.
